The 3 best skincare oils that will leave your face matte!

I love oils. I use them on my body, on my body, on my hair, etc. The oils are just amazing and I usually stick to only using organic, cold pressed and unrefined oils because I think these are the best as they retain a lot of the healing properties inherent in them that can benefit my skin, hair and internally. if they are oils that can be consumed.

I have combination/oily skin and while using one oil over another sounds crazy, it works for me. I’ve been doing this for years, whether I use an oil as a night cream or as a daily moisturizer or both.

Instead of drying out my skin like many moisturizers that target combination/oily skin do, which just ends up producing more oil, using oils to moisturize my skin seems to calm my oil glands and not cause them to go into overdrive to produce more oil because my skin is not stripped of oil.

I still get oily during the day when I use an oil to moisturize, but I still feel like using an oil is better for my skin. And when I use an oil as a night cream, most mornings I wake up to skin that looks amazing.

While I have used many, many different oils and I don’t care if they leave my face a little shiny or not, the following three oils are the best skincare oils I have tried so far that leave my skin looking matte, although when it touches your skin, it will not feel dry but moisturized. This is especially beneficial if you want to use an oil on your face but hate the grease that some oils can leave behind.

The 3 best oils for skin care

1. Emu oil

I only use this on my face because it’s pretty expensive for the amount you get. If I had to pick an overall winner, it would be emu oil, although the others on my list are excellent too. When I use emu oil, I have more days looking at my skin in the mirror because of how smooth and amazing it looks!

Emu oil is definitely one of the best skincare oils you can use and you will be amazed at how matte your skin will look while still feeling hydrated. After applying it, it quickly absorbs into the skin to leave your skin looking matte.

One thing to remember about emu oil, especially if you’re trying to avoid animal products, is that this oil is made from the emu bird, which is native to Australia and New Zealand.

Emu oil is obtained after harvesting the meat of the birds, which means that this oil cannot be obtained if the bird is alive. All bird parts are used in some way. The skin or leather is commonly used in the fashion clothing industry in Europe, the meat can be a substitute for beef while the oil has many healing properties when applied topically. It should not be taken internally.. Each bird can produce around 5 liters of the oil which is then taken through a refining process that varies from manufacturer to manufacturer.

Try to use only the best quality that has no contaminants or other ingredients in the oil because if the refining process is excellent there will be no need for any other ingredients including preservatives so the best oil to use should be 100 percent. cent emu oil. .

Emu oil is truly an amazing oil that contains many antifungal, antibacterial, and antiviral properties, as well as anti-inflammatory properties that can help heal the skin, which is why it is commonly recommended for those struggling with acne, psoriasis, eczema, and acne. many other skin problems and is also commonly used on burn victims to help the skin heal.

It’s also recommended for aging skin, so I love emu oil. When used on the hair, it can help moisturize the hair and heal the scalp, and in some circles, it’s recommended to treat hair loss!

2. Hemp oil

While this is made from the Cannabis sativa plant, which is most commonly used to make the recreational drug marijuana, using this oil as opposed to the drug will not cause you to fail any drug tests. There is a misconception that hemp contains THC, which is the main psychoactive component of the cannabis plant, but this is not true.

Not only do I find hemp seed oil to be one of the best oils for skin care, but I also use it on my hair and take it internally because it contains the perfect ratio of essential fatty acids (EFAs) omega 6 and omega 3 found in nature.

I usually add a scoop to my morning smoothie. These fatty acids, as well as the many other healing properties that hemp seed oil contains when taken internally, will help promote overall health and wellness while protecting you from various diseases and chronic conditions.

This is another one of the best face oils that will absorb quickly into your skin and leave your skin looking matte yet hydrated. When you use unrefined, cold-pressed, organic hemp oil, you will have access to all the healing properties of this oil for your skin, hair, scalp, and body.

3. Rosehip oil

This is another plant-based oil that is one of the best skin care oils that will be quickly absorbed by the skin to leave it looking matte but feeling hydrated.

Rosehip oil is made from the seeds of rose bushes that are grown predominantly in South America. It is one of the most beneficial skincare oils because it is full of vitamins, antioxidants, and essential fatty acids (EFAs) that correct dark spots, moisturize dry and itchy skin, reduce scars and fine lines, and help treat many other skin problems.

Again, only use unrefined, organic, cold-pressed rosehip oil because it will be packed with these various healing properties.

These in my book are the best skincare oils you can use to moisturize your skin without making it look greasy/oily or just some of the best skincare oils! If using an oil on your face seems like too much, you can add a drop or two to any moisturizer you use to get some of the healing benefits these oils contain.
